POSITION SUMMARY

A technician position is available in the lab of Dr. DaZhi Wang, Director of the Center for Regenerative Medicine. The selected candidate will work with lab members on projects investigating the molecular mechanisms that regulate muscle development and growth, and their role in human disease. The lab employs mouse cardiac and skeletal muscle models, as well as tissue culture. In particular, the lab studies transcriptional regulation and the roles of and mechanisms for noncoding RNA‑mediated posttranscriptional regulation.

Ongoing studies are focused on the role of multiple lncRNAs in the regulation of gene expression in mouse models and normal and diseased cardiovascular states.

SB 1310

Senate Bill 1310:
Substitution of Work Experience for Postsecondary Education Requirements. A public employer may include a postsecondary degree as a baseline requirement only as an alternative to the number of years of direct experience required, not to exceed:

  • Two years of direct experience for an associate degree.
  • Four years of direct experience for a bachelor’s degree.
  • Six years of direct experience for a master’s degree.
  • Seven years of direct experience for a professional degree.
  • Nine years of direct experience for a doctoral degree.

Related work experience may not substitute for any required licensure, certification, or registration required for the position of employment as established by the public employer and indicated in the advertised description of the position of employment.

Minimum qualifications that require a high school diploma are exempt from SB 1310.
